If you purchased through Apple:
Open the Settings app on your device.
Tap on your Apple ID at the top of the screen.
Select Subscriptions.
Find your subscription to NHTI Advising and tap on it.
Scroll down and select Report a Problem.
Choose Request a Refund and fill out the form.
Mention that the subscription renewed without notice.
Submit your request.
If you purchased through Google Play:
Open the Google Play Store app on your device.
Tap the Menu icon (three horizontal lines) in the top left corner.
Select Subscriptions.
Find your subscription for NHTI Advising and tap on it.
Select Cancel Subscription.
In the feedback section, state that you wish to request a refund.
Note that the account was not actively used.
Submit your request.
